[0001] This utility model relates to the field of construction equipment technology, and in particular to an opening and closing device for the cage door of a construction hoist. Background Technology

[0002] Construction hoist cage doors refer to the entrance and exit doors on the construction hoist cage. These doors are typically designed as single or double doors, installed on the cage, and used for personnel entry and exit as well as material loading and unloading.12 Cage doors are an important component of construction hoists; they not only provide access to the cage but also play a crucial role in ensuring construction safety. The opening and closing mechanism of the construction hoist cage door is a mechanical device used to control the opening and closing of the cage door. It is usually used in conjunction with an electric or manual drive system to ensure that the construction hoist door can be opened and closed conveniently and safely. The cage door is a vital component of the construction hoist, and ensuring its proper opening and closing is crucial for ensuring construction safety.

[0003] The existing opening and closing devices for construction hoist cage doors are not easy to open and close stably in actual use. The cage door body is prone to shaking when opening and closing, causing wear and tear on the equipment. Utility Model Content

[0005] The purpose of this utility model is to provide an opening and closing device for the cage door of a construction hoist, so as to solve the problem mentioned in the background art that it is not easy to open and close the cage door body stably, and the cage door body is easy to shake and cause equipment wear when opening and closing.

[0006] (II) Technical Solution

[0007] To achieve the above objectives, this utility model provides the following technical solution: An opening and closing device for a construction hoist cage door includes two sets of cage door bodies. A door frame is slidably connected to the surface of each cage door body. A positioning block is fixedly connected to one side of the top of each door frame. A lifting assembly is rotatably connected inside the positioning block. Several sets of rolling assemblies are slidably connected inside the door frame. Four sets of buffer assemblies are fixedly connected in a rectangular array to one side of each cage door body. A protective frame is fixedly connected to one end of each buffer assembly. The lifting assembly includes a threaded rod rotatably connected inside the positioning block. A drive motor is fixedly connected to the top of the threaded rod, and a connecting block is threadedly connected to the bottom of the threaded rod. The rolling assembly includes a sliding rod slidably connected inside the door frame. Rollers are rotatably connected to the surface of the sliding rod. Support springs are fixedly connected to both ends of the sliding rod, and a positioning rod is sleeved inside each support spring. The buffer assembly includes a damping hydraulic rod fixedly connected in a rectangular array to one side of the cage door body. Buffer springs are sleeved on the surface of the damping hydraulic rod.

[0014] (III) Beneficial Effects

[0015] This utility model provides an opening and closing device for the cage door of a construction hoist, which has the following beneficial effects:

[0016] 1. This opening and closing device for the cage door of a construction hoist, through the arrangement of a lifting component and a rolling component, operates by starting a drive motor to rotate a threaded rod. The threaded rod rotates within the connecting block, causing the cage door body to slide and rise within the door frame, thus opening and closing the cage door body. Simultaneously, as the cage door body slides within the door frame, its surface presses against the roller surface, causing the roller to rotate on the sliding rod surface. This pressure forces the sliding rod to compress the support spring, and the positioning rod slides to maintain stability, thereby achieving stable opening and closing of the cage door body and preventing swaying during opening and closing. Furthermore, by replacing sliding friction with rolling friction, friction is significantly reduced, thus minimizing equipment wear.

[0017] 2. The opening and closing device for the cage door of the construction hoist, through the setting of buffer components and protective frames, allows for the movement and collision of goods when personnel transport them into the cage body. Due to the shaking of the hoist during operation, the goods may move and collide. When the goods collide with the protective frame, the protective frame transmits pressure to the damping hydraulic rod, causing the damping hydraulic rod to contract under force, and the buffer spring to deform under force and generate elastic force, thereby achieving the effect of buffering and shock absorption of the collision, avoiding damage to the cage door body caused by the collision, and improving the service life of the opening and closing device for the cage door of the construction hoist. [0032] In this invention, the working steps of the device are as follows:

[0033] First step: When in use, start the drive motor 402 to drive the threaded rod 401 to rotate, and then the threaded rod 401 rotates in the connecting block 403, and drives the cage door body 1 to slide and rise inside the door frame 2, thereby opening and closing the cage door body 1.

[0034] Second step: Simultaneously, when the cage door body 1 slides inside the door frame 2, the cage door body 1 presses against the surface of the roller 502, causing the roller 502 to rotate on the surface of the sliding rod 501. The pressing force causes the sliding rod 501 to push the support spring 503 to contract under force, and the positioning rod 504 slides to maintain stability.

[0035] The third step: When in use, personnel transport goods into the main body 9 of the hoist. Due to the shaking caused by the operation of the hoist, the goods may move and collide. When the goods collide with the protective frame 7, the protective frame 7 transmits pressure to the damping hydraulic rod 601, causing the damping hydraulic rod 601 to contract under force, and the buffer spring 602 to deform under force and generate elastic force.
